We return to our hour long format. This week we discuss how to integrate a group of technologically disparate members. How well does that Roman centurion surf the web? How well does that Krelvin handle plugging together the 8-track stereo? How much is the user friendliness of our tech just a cultural norm? We discuss how a gm can use various rpg systems to represent this "culture shock"

This week we finish our discussion of solo campaigns where there is just a single player and GM and the player only plays one character. Success in this kind of campaign is fairly hard to achieve, yet many new players or GM's wishing to play a new game find themselve here. We give our best tips for successful character creation, equipment selection, and adventure design.
